The relationship between myocardial blood flow and bradycardia in man

Abstract
Myocardial blood flow was measured in patients with chronic complete heart block at each patient's idioventricular rate and at a paced rate of 80 and 100/min. Myocardial flow was found to be positively related to the increase in heart rate and a possible mechanism for this is suggested.Keywords
